How they compare

East Asia & Pacific (IDA & IBRD countries) currently reports 24.48 million current US$ against 5.74 million current US$ in Croatia, a difference of 18.74 million current US$.

That makes East Asia & Pacific (IDA & IBRD countries)'s figure about 4.3 times Croatia's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 17 shared years of data; in 1994 it was Croatia ahead.

Croatia ranks 29th and East Asia & Pacific (IDA & IBRD countries) ranks 32nd of 154 countries.

East Asia & Pacific (IDA & IBRD countries) has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Net bilateral aid flows from DAC donors, Austria (current US$) with 389 missing years estimated by linear interpolation between the nearest real observations. Only gaps of 4 years or fewer are filled, and never beyond the first or last actual measurement — these are filled holes, not forecasts.
